British Airways pilot strike affects Cancun flights

Cancun, Q.R. — A pilot strike by British Airways has forced the cancellation of nearly all its flights including those to Cancun. Executives from the Cancun International Airport have reported the cancellation of at least two London-Cancun flights due to the strike.

The two canceled flights included BA2203 London-Cancun as well as the BA2202 Cancun-London, both scheduled for Monday. Cancun airport executives from Grupo Aeroportuario del Sureste (ASUR) say that for now, the remaining scheduled flights are expected to arrive as planned. However, passengers flying British Airways are advised to check the status of their flights.

Nearly all British Airway flights have been canceled for both Monday and Tuesday while the British Airline Pilots Association (BALPA) attempts to work out a heated dispute over pay with the airline. The strike is set to last 48-hours, however, BALPA says they are planning another strike for September 27 since current negotiations show no signs of abating.

According to reports, nearly 200,000 passengers were scheduled to travel on September 9 and 10 via British Airways.
